As agreed, we are moving from Harwick Freight to Callendo Logistics effective the first of next month. Callendo will handle all branch deliveries, including the Tellborough and Ainsmere depots. Delivery windows shift to mornings; branch managers should update receiving rosters accordingly. Harwick will complete outstanding runs through month-end. Escalation paths and driver schedules are in the shared operations folder. Please brief your teams this week. The rationale for the switch ties into the confidential plan noted below.

management briefing: Project Ulavan slips by two quarters because of the staffing delay.

### Step 4: Enable the Reconciliation Job

After the stock tables migrate, enable the Ledgerbin reconciliation job so nightly counts match the new schema. Support should confirm the first run completes without variance alerts before closing any customer tickets about stock levels. The job pulls its settings from the environment at startup, and the required values are listed below.

deployment values, kahof-yadug:
[gorys]
team = silael
access_code = ac_00d620
owner = istox.oliys
host = gorys.torvastack.example
port = 9000
peer = holmir.merlaqsoft.example
salt = 9fdae78a
pin = 2358

### Step 4: Migrate the solver config

Before cutting the Tessera 5 release, port the timetable solver settings from the legacy file into the new schema. Old keys are ignored silently — verify each one. Room-capacity weights changed units from percent to ratio; convert accordingly. Run the dry-run validator before tagging. The target values for this release are as follows.

config for kafof-bawef:
holath:
  log_level: debug
  metrics_host: metrics.holath.qorvelsys.internal
  pin: 2191
  pool_size: 32

Finance Review Summary — Brindlecore Plus Tier

To heads of department: the new Brindlecore Plus subscription tier launched on schedule. Uptake at 6% of active base, above forecast. ARPU up 11%; churn flat. Support costs slightly elevated due to onboarding queries. Margin impact positive from month two. Pricing holds through Q3; no discounting authorised. Full model refresh due next cycle. Direction for the tier's expansion is set out in the note below.

internal memo for yaduf-fahap: The board signed off on a budget of $4.5 million for Project Ralix. The renewal with Eliokox Freight closes at $63.8 million a year, 9 percent below the last contract.